Discovering Zanzibars Cultural Center



Stepping into Stone Town, usually considered the cultural center of Zanzibar, is comparable to strolling through a living museum. The Old Fort, an imposing framework that observed countless battles, now holds lively social occasions. The neighborhood markets teem with colorful spices and indigenous art.

The Appeal of Zanzibar's Villages: a Journey Into Resident Life



zanzibar tourszanzibar tours
Have you ever questioned what exists beyond the bustling markets and popular vacationer areas of Zanzibar? The charm of Zanzibar's towns uses an intimate look into neighborhood life. Snuggled away from the regular vacationer tracks, these towns maintain a sense of credibility, a picture of typical Zanzibari lifestyle. The citizens participate in olden way of livings, their days noted by fishing, farming and weaving. Each town has a special personality, reflected in its style, routines, and festivals. The small huts, the scent of neighborhood delicacies, the laughter of kids playing, all add to the allure. Visitors can immerse themselves in the rhythm of town life, acquiring a deeper understanding of Zanzibari society. This is the heart of Zanzibar, waiting to be found and treasured.
